Navigation System Symptom Troubleshooting - Voice guidance cannot be heard

Voice guidance cannot be heard
Diagnostic Test: Navi System Link
NOTE:
  • Always check the connectors for poor connections or loose terminals.
  • Before troubleshooting, write down the customer's radio station presets.
  • After troubleshooting, enter the radio station presets.
  1. Press the navigation display MENU button.
  1. Check the volume and voice feedback setting for the navigation system in setting screen.
Is either set to OFF?
YES -
Set the voice feedback to ON and select an audible level for the volume.■
NO -
Go to Step 3 .
  1. Check the radio operation.
Can you hear the radio?
YES -
Go to Step 4 .
NO -
Troubleshoot the audio system.■
